目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95

这篇具有很好参考价值的文章主要介绍了目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

Average Precision (AP)和Average Recall (AR)

AP是单个类别平均精确度,而mAP是所有类别的平均精确度。

AP是Precision-Recall Curve曲线下面的面积。

    曲线面积越大说明AP的值越大,类别的检测精度就越高。Recall是召回率,也叫查全率,Precision是准确率,也叫查准率,两者是相互矛盾的指标,如果能够较好的平衡两者,将在不同的条件下得到较好的检测效果,也就是曲线面积。

目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95

混淆矩阵中(上图):
True Positive区域:正样本预测为正样本
False Positive区域:负样本预测为正样本
False Negative区域:正样本预测为负样本
True Negative区域:负样本预测为负样本

注意:Flase和Ture表示错误判断和正确判断;Postive和Negative表示预测结果是正还是负。
如 False Positive :错误判断为正,说明实际为负;判断为正,判断错了。同理,False Negative:错误判断为负,说明实际为正;判断为负,判断错了。

预测样本在检测中就是预测框的大小,我们设置的IoU就是指的真实框与预测框的交并比,如果大于阈值就是正确,小于就是错误。

目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95

  • IoU=0.50意味着IoU大于0.5被认为是检测到,即将IoU设为0.5时,计算每一类的所有图片的AP,然后所有类别求平均,即mAP。
  • IoU=0.50:0.95意味着IoU在0.5到0.95的范围内被认为是检测到,表示在不同IoU阈值(从0.50到0.95,步长0.05)(0.5、0.55、0.6、0.65、0.7、0.75、0.8、0.85、0.9、0.95)上的平均mAP。
  • 越低的IoU阈值,则判为正确检测的越多,相应的,Average Precision (AP)也就越高。参考上面的第二第三行。
  • small表示标注的框面积小于32 * 32
  • medium表示标注的框面积同时小于96 * 96
  • large表示标注的框面积大于等于96 * 96
  • all表示不论大小,我都要。
  • maxDets=100表示最大检测目标数为100。

目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95

目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95

 训练之后的mAP结果图类似于下图:

目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95文章来源地址https://www.toymoban.com/news/detail-485360.html

到了这里,关于目标检测结果IOU不同取值的含义 IoU=0.50与IoU=0.50:0.95的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包